|
The Software Update Wizard lets you add 'update over the web' functionality to your applications with just a single line of code. You simply upload your revised software files, together with a simple script, to your web server. No server-side processing is needed, so this solution works with any server or ISP. The Software Update Wizard is a single, one-off, non-recurrent cost - there are no ongoing fees or additional costs. The Software Update Wizard is also fully compatible with Windows Vista!
Your application calls a DLL, which handles all subsequent communications with the server and launches any subsequent processes needed to complete the update.
Add Automatic Software Updates to your application with a single line of code
Each time one of your users or customers runs your software, the Software Update Wizard will automatically check (providing the user is on line or connected to the network) whether any updates are available and download / install them as required. You can control whether the updates happen automatically or if your users should be prompted whether they would like to update their software.
As part of the update process your script can launch processes on the user's machine, post messages to the user during the process, replace in-use files via a reboot and even submit confirmation back to the software developer that an update was successfully processed. The Software Update Wizard operates as a Windows Service application - updates can therefore be deployed using the SYSTEM security context and do not require the user to have Administrator privileges.
The Software Update Wizard works with any ISP (Internet Service Provider) – you do not need your own web server. No processing whatever takes place on the web server (other than standard http requests!). Software Update Wizard works with any development enviroment capable of making Windows DLL calls
|
|
|
Free UPX: http://www.pazera-software.com/download.php?id=0022&f=Free_UPX.zip
Free UPX is an advanced graphical interface for the UPX (Ultimate Packer for eXecutables).
It allows you to compress (and decompress) files produced according to Microsoft Portable Executable and COFF Specification (EXE, DLL, OCX, BPL, CPL and other). It offers easy access to all documented and undocumented UPX parameters without the need for command line usage.
The Free UPX interface is very simple and user-friendly. To compress executable files, just drag & drop them into main window, select proper profile from list, and click the COMPRESS button.
Free UPX is designed for UPX 3.03w - the last stable version in July 2008.
The most important features:
* Compression and decompression executable files (EXE, DLL, OCX, BPL, CPL, SYS, AX, ACM, DRV, TLB and other).
* Easy acces to all UPX command-line parameters.
* Displaying detailed informations about compressed files: original file size, compresson ratio, UPX version, compression level and other.
* Predefined UPX profiles for beginners. Advanced users can define custom profiles.
* Don't need any installation. Just extract ZIP archive and click fupx.exe file.
* Portability. This program can be run from portable devices. All settings are written to INI file.
* Shell integration (optional).
* 100% freeware! - for commercial and non-commercial use. No limitations, no adware, no spyware.
Created with a legal and registered version of the Turbo Delphi Explorer. |